Eagles assistant Jim Johnson, dead at 68, recalled as ‘incredible gem’

July 29th, 2009

In the training camp of the Philadelphia Eagles and across the NFL, Jim Johnson is remembered as the ultimate assistant coach. As a motivator, he was tough, yet sensitive. As a defensive mastermind, he cut his players loose to blitz, blitz, blitz the quarterback.Johnson, defensive coordinator of the Eagles for the past decade, died Tuesday at age 68 after a battle with cancer. He had taken a leave of absence in May. “The whole Eagle-Andy Reid regime here that’s taken place, it wouldn’t have been possible without Jim.
